They look fine -- I've seen worse egg pictures posted on this forum make beautiful babies. Keep an eye on the brown spot tho - you might need to tend to it if it looks like it's spreading.



For the next clutch you might want to d a little tweaking on the hovabator:

I like to put as much damp substrate into the egg box as I can - this way there is a lot more water inside the tub to help prevent drying out to begin with. It also helps to keep temperatures inside the egg box more stable.

Take out the chicken wire and plastic piece in the bottom and just put the egg box right on the bottom of the Hov - this will keep the eggs a little farther away from the heat coil and help keep them from drying out.

If you put some water bottles in the Hov. around the egg box it will help stabilize temps and keep the heating coil from kicking on all the time (which will also keep from drying out the eggs).
